| germ layer | <embryology> A layer of cells produced during the process of gastrulation during the early development of the animal embryo, which is distinct from other such layers of cells, as an early step of cell differentiation. The three types of germ layers are the endoderm, ectoderm, and mesoderm. Diploblastic organisms (e.g. Coelenterates) have two layers, ectoderm and endoderm, triploblastic organisms (all higher animal groups) have mesoderm between these two layers. Germ layers become distinguishable during late blastula/early gastrula stages of embryogenesis and each gives rise to a characteristic set of tissues, the ectoderm to external epithelia and to the nervous system for example: although some tissues contain elements derived from two layers. | germ layer theory | The developmental biology theory that during early development, the animal embryo divides itself into two or three germ layers, each of which then proceed to further differentiate into organs and tissues specific to that particular layer. (09 Oct 1997) |
| hair cells, inner | Bulbous cells that are medially placed in one row in the organ of corti. In contrast to the outer hair cells, the inner hair cells are fewer in number, have fewer sensory hairs, and are less differentiated. (12 Dec 1998) |

| inner cell mass | A group of cells found in the mammalian blastocyst that give rise to the embryo and are potentially capable of forming all tissues, embryonic and extra embryonic, except the trophoblast. (18 Nov 1997) |
| inner dental epithelium | Inner enamel epithelium, the columnar epithelial layer of enamel matrix, secreting ameloblasts, of the odontogenic organ of a developing tooth. (05 Mar 2000) |
| inner malleolus | The process at the medial side of the lower end of the tibia, forming the projection of the medial side of the ankle. Synonym: malleolus medialis, inner malleolus, internal malleolus. (05 Mar 2000) |

| inner sheath | The material that encases the two central microtubules of the ciliary axoneme. (18 Nov 1997) |
| inner table of skull | The inner compact layer of the cranial bones. Synonym: lamina interna cranii. (05 Mar 2000) |
| Ehrlich's inner body | A round oxyphil body found in the red blood cell in case of haemocytolysis due to a specific blood poison. Synonym: Heinz-Ehrlich body. (05 Mar 2000) |

| germ cell | Cell specialised to produce haploid gametes. The germ cell line is often formed very early in embryonic development. (18 Nov 1997) |
| germ cells | The reproductive cells in multicellular organisms. (12 Dec 1998) |
